Estimating as the Starting Point of Financial Planning
A construction estimate provides an early financial picture of a proposed project. It is developed by examining the scope represented in drawings, specifications, schedules, and related documents.
The process typically involves identifying the work required, measuring quantities, researching applicable costs, evaluating labor, and organizing the information into a structured report.
This gives stakeholders something more useful than a single total. They can see how different portions of the development contribute to the projected expenditure.
For example, a contractor may discover that a particular finish package represents a larger portion of the budget than expected. That information can lead to discussions about alternative products or design adjustments before the project reaches the field.
Why New York Projects Need Detailed Analysis
Construction conditions can differ significantly throughout New York. A project in Manhattan may present very different logistical circumstances from one in Buffalo, Rochester, Syracuse, or a suburban community.
Urban projects can involve restricted access, limited storage space, complicated deliveries, occupied neighboring properties, and coordination challenges. Other locations may introduce different transportation, workforce, or site-related considerations.
These factors can influence project costs even when two buildings have similar designs.
A location-sensitive approach helps ensure that the financial forecast reflects the circumstances surrounding the actual development rather than depending entirely on generalized averages.
Turning Drawings Into Measurable Quantities
Construction drawings contain a tremendous amount of information, but that information must be interpreted correctly before it can be priced.
Estimators review the documents to identify dimensions, materials, assemblies, systems, and quantities. Depending on the scope, the takeoff may cover everything from excavation and foundations to structural components, exterior envelopes, interior finishes, and building services.
The process can reveal discrepancies between drawings and specifications. It may also bring attention to areas where information is incomplete.
Finding these issues during pre-construction is valuable because project teams have an opportunity to request clarification before the work reaches the construction stage.
Detailed Takeoffs Help Strengthen Cost Control
Quantity accuracy directly influences the quality of a budget. If the estimated quantity is incorrect, the associated cost will also be affected.
For example, a small error in a unit of flooring may have limited impact on a small room but become significant across a large commercial facility. Similar issues can occur with concrete, drywall, roofing, insulation, piping, or other high-volume materials.
A disciplined takeoff process reduces the likelihood of these oversights. Each trade can be reviewed separately, creating a traceable connection between project documents and the final financial projection.
Labor Forecasting and Productivity
Labor is often one of the most challenging elements to predict because productivity can vary according to site conditions, crew experience, construction methods, and project complexity.
Estimators consider the work involved and establish appropriate labor allowances based on available information and accepted estimating practices.
Understanding labor requirements can benefit both bidding and scheduling. If a particular activity requires a large workforce or specialized personnel, that requirement can be identified before the contractor commits to a project.
This knowledge can also help businesses determine whether they have sufficient internal capacity or should rely on subcontractors for certain scopes.

Supporting Value Engineering
Cost estimating can also support value engineering. When the projected budget exceeds the owner’s target, simply cutting random items may not be the best solution.
Instead, project teams can review specific components and explore alternatives.
A different finish, structural approach, equipment selection, or installation method may provide comparable performance at a lower cost. By identifying the financial impact of individual elements, estimating gives designers and owners information they can use during these discussions.
The earlier this process takes place, the more opportunities there may be to make meaningful changes.
Renovation Requires a Different Perspective
Existing structures often contain unknowns that are not present in new construction. Renovation estimates must account for the available information about the existing property while recognizing that some conditions cannot be confirmed until areas are opened.
This can include concealed utilities, deteriorated structural elements, outdated mechanical systems, previous alterations, or difficult access.
A well-organized renovation estimate should clearly distinguish confirmed scope from assumptions and allowances. Doing so gives the owner a more realistic understanding of where financial uncertainty exists.
Estimating Can Assist Procurement Planning
Once quantities and projected costs are established, procurement teams have a clearer basis for purchasing decisions.
They can compare supplier quotations against expected quantities and identify materials that may require early ordering. This is especially important for products with long manufacturing or delivery periods.
Procurement planning can also reduce unnecessary emergency purchases. When requirements are understood ahead of time, project teams have more opportunity to evaluate suppliers and delivery options.
Digital Tools Are Changing the Process
Modern estimating increasingly relies on digital technology. Electronic plans can be measured using specialized takeoff software, while estimating platforms can organize unit costs, labor data, and trade breakdowns.
Digital workflows can also make revisions easier to manage. When an architect issues an updated drawing, the estimator can identify affected areas and revise the corresponding quantities.
Despite these advantages, software should not be treated as a substitute for professional judgment. Construction documents can contain details that require interpretation, and pricing must be evaluated in the context of the actual project.
Human review remains essential for quality control.
